Fr. John Brancich, FSSP, is the pastor of St. Stanislaus Catholic Church in Nashua, New Hampshire. He was ordained into the Priestly Fraternity of Saint Peter in 2004. In Today's Show: ​​What is the best way to end a confession? Should you wait to sit at Mass until the priest sits? Does the church offer Holy Communion to those with dementia, Down Syndrome, or other mental impairments? Historically, how were deaf people able to assist at the traditional Latin mass? Is it ever ok to swear to express frustration? Why have people tried to change the Canon of the Mass? How do Catholics interpret the relationship in the Song of Songs? What is a Mass stipend? How many Masses should be said for a deceased loved one? Is there a difference between praying to God the Father and Jesus? How do Jesus and Mary feel about gay people?
